Cardiac Metabolic Remodeling After Pulmonary Vasodilator Therapy in Pulmonary Arterial Hypertension: A Pilot Study
Stopped early
Conditions studied: Pulmonary Arterial Hypertension, Right-Sided Heart Failure
In brief
Pulmonary arterial hypertension(PAH) is associated with the development of right heart failure. In the setting of heart failure, the heart shifts to increasing dependence on glucose metabolism. In this study, the investigators will perform cardiac positron emission tomography/magnetic resonance imaging (PET/MRI) scans to measure glucose metabolism in the heart before and after initiation of pulmonary vasodilator therapy for pulmonary arterial hypertension.

Who can join
Age: 18 and older, up to 75. Sex: any. Healthy volunteers: not accepted.
You may qualify if…
- World Health Organization(WHO) group PAH secondary into idiopathic pulmonary arterial hypertension(IPAH) or connective tissue disease associated pulmonary arterial hypertension (CTDPAH)
- New York Heart Association (NYHA) classification I - III heart failure
- Vasodilator therapy naive
- Able to provide informed consent
You may not qualify if…
- Metabolic disorders such as uncontrolled diabetes (A1c > 8%) that may interfere with FDG uptake
- Baseline 6-minute walk distance (6MWD) < 400 feet or NYHA class IV heart failure
- Musculoskeletal abnormalities that would prevent exercise
- Contraindications to MRI
